Fred talks with John Burns about whether adding a suppressor to your rifle make it more or less accurate. https://wyomingarms.com/suppressors ...By preventing the rapid expansion of thousands of pounds per square inch of gas pressure, the bullet leaves the suppressor at a much lower volume, decreasing sound by up to 40 decibels. While materials and internal designs vary, this basic function is common to every suppressor. An air gun suppressor (or silencer) is only intended to quiet the report of an airgun since most airguns fire at low velocities and do not break the sound barrier. Whereas firearms break the sound barrier and would require a much more powerful silencing device. Air gun suppressors are not the same as firearm silencers.

Suppressors make sense, but acquiring one legally can be burdensome and discouraging if you aren’t familiar with it. …When making the suppressor do all the threading on the lathe with a single point cutter, do not use taps or dies they are not accurate enough to keep the threads in line with the bore. Everything need to be extreamly straight or you will get baffle strikes. I drill my .22 cores with a .250" dia drill then ream them with a .252" dia reamer. Tyler Freel. “These dedicated ranges enhance safety, reduce environmental impacts of shooting, and contribute to the recruitment and retention of ethical hunters and shooters,” says ..., Firearm suppressor disassembled to show blast chamber, baffles, and sections of the outer tube. A silencer is typically a hollow metal tube made from steel, aluminum, or titanium and contains expansion chambers. It is usually cylindrical in shape, and attaches to the muzzle of a pistol, submachine gun, or rifle., The good news is that it is cheaper than the actual suppressor and people can do it by themselves at home. In theory, the new Texas law would allow residents to purchase Texas-made suppressors without going through the long and arduous process that involves NFA paperwork and the $200 tax stamp. In practice, however, the new Texas law does little – if anything – when it comes to purchasing suppressors., Homemade suppressors, like rubber bands used to make bump stocks and modified assault weapons, provide an avenue around restrictions.
